Description:
The Ministry of Health, Health Programs Delivery Division, Drug Programs Policy and Strategy Branch, Negotiations & Contracts Management Unit seeks an experienced Registered Pharmacist to provide pharmaceutical and clinical expertise to senior management and stakeholders.
PHARMACEUTICAL AND DRUG KNOWLEDGE AND SKILLS
- You have extensive knowledge of pharmacology, therapeutics and pharmaceuticals to provide expert advice
- You have knowledge of Ontario’s drug programs, the pharmaceutical industry and pharmacy practice
- You have a good understanding of the pharmacy operations, programs and legislation to ensure consistency, and to assess changes on policies and programs
POLICY ANALYSIS, PROJECT MANAGEMENT AND ORGANIZATIONAL SKILLS
- You can develop policies and programs, and resolve policy issues using program analysis skills
- You can analyze policies to evaluate current benefits and resolve problems
- You can plan, assign and coordinate activities using project management skills
- You can use organizational and management theories to facilitate the operations of the unit
COMMUNICATION AND COMPUTER SKILLS
- You have excellent communication and consultation skills to respond to clients
- You can maintain effective working relationships with project team members and stakeholders
- You can prepare complex technical reports using written communication skills
- You can use information systems technology to collect and analyze data
Responsibilities:
As a Senior Pharmacist, you will:
- Act as a scientific adviser and provide analysis and expertise to senior management and stakeholders
- Coordinate and support drug utilization projects, and resolve project related issues
- Determine program and policy changes, their impact and usefulness
- Conduct analysis of data and manage data on technology databases to support reviews
- Develop, negotiate and implement policies related to the listing of drug products
- Coordinate transparency bulletins or similar initiatives
- Lead and manage issues, including liaising with patient members and stakeholders
- Participate on advisory committees
